Subject: Attributes 'Version and 'Body_Version

On my way to playing around with something else, I started looking at the
results of the attributes 'Version and 'Body_Version with Gnat 3.13p on
WinNT. They appear to be intended for distributed systems, but could
potentially be useful within any system that uses someone's library of
stuff - a means of verifying that any assumed behavior from a given version
is still valid. Or, for example, a means of recording the version of a
package that produced some particular output so that on input, version
differences can be accommodated.

Looking at the strings from a particular package (a generic instantiatiation
at that) I see a pair of strings that look like: "2daafe2a" (spec)
"21adf138" (body) I didn't encounter anything in the ARM indicating what the
format of the string should be nor did I see anything in the GNAT documents
that explained how to interpret the string. Obviously, this is going to be
system dependent, but if you want to do anything more than say "This version
isn't the one I remember" you need to know how to interpret the string. Has
anybody used this before and possibly have some insight? Thanks.
